Advantages of Using Water Flossers
Water flossers offer a range of benefits that can enhance your oral hygiene routine. They are designed to reach those hard-to-access areas between teeth and along the gumline, which is where traditional brushing and flossing often fall short. The pulsating water stream is not only effective at removing plaque and food debris but also gentle on the gums, reducing the risk of damage that can be caused by aggressive brushing or flossing techniques.
The convenience of water flossers is another significant advantage. They are easy to use, especially for individuals with limited dexterity or those wearing braces, dental bridges, or other oral appliances. Many models come with adjustable pressure settings, allowing you to tailor the force of the water stream to your comfort and oral health needs. This customization can make water flossing a more pleasant experience.
The massaging effect of the water pressure can also stimulate blood circulation in the gums, promoting overall gum health. Regular use of water flossers has been linked to improved gum health by reducing gingivitis and the risk of gum disease. Additionally, some water flossers are portable, making them an excellent travel companion for maintaining oral hygiene on the go.
For those who find traditional flossing to be time-consuming or tedious, water flossers can be a time-saving alternative. They can quickly clean multiple areas between teeth, potentially reducing the overall time spent on oral hygiene. Some models even allow you to add mouthwash to the water reservoir, which can enhance the cleaning effect and leave your mouth feeling fresh.
Lastly, water flossers can be particularly beneficial for individuals with special dental needs, such as those with dental implants, crowns, or bridges. They can help maintain cleanliness around these restorations, ensuring the longevity of dental work. The ease and effectiveness of water flossers may also encourage better compliance with a daily oral hygiene routine, which is essential for maintaining good dental health.
It's important to remember that while water flossers provide these benefits, they should be used in conjunction with regular brushing and other dental hygiene practices. Consulting with a dental professional can help you determine the most suitable oral care routine for your specific needs.
